Recognizing Costs Intraocular Lenses
When you take into consideration cataract surgery, comprehending costs intraocular lenses (IOLs) is important for achieving the most effective possible vision results.
Premium IOLs offer choices like multifocal and toric lenses, which can improve your vision at various distances and correct astigmatism. Unlike typical lenses, premium IOLs can decrease your dependancy on glasses post-surgery.
It is essential to review your way of life and aesthetic needs when discussing these options with your surgeon. They'll help you establish which lens kind lines up with your everyday tasks and expectations.
Advantages and Dangers of Premium Lens Options
While premium lens alternatives can considerably improve your vision, it's vital to consider both their advantages and potential threats.
These lenses can decrease your dependancy on glasses, improve contrast level of sensitivity, and offer a broader range of vision. Nevertheless, some individuals may experience aesthetic disturbances, such as halos or glow, especially during the night.
In addition, premium lenses commonly come with a higher price, which may not be covered by insurance. It's likewise worth keeping in mind that not everybody is an ideal candidate; certain eye problems can impact results.
